Normal Operation
Under normal operation, to rotate the mode door actuator clockwise, the EMTC module supplies voltage to the BLEND, DEFROST and FLOOR/PANEL mode door actuator motors through the door actuator feed B circuits, and supplies ground through the door actuator feed A circuits. To rotate the mode door actuator counterclockwise, the EMTC module reverses the voltage and ground circuits.

The mode door actuator feedback resistors are supplied a ground from the EMTC module by the mode door actuator return circuits and a 5-volt reference voltage on the mode door actuator reference circuits. The EMTC module reads the voltage on the mode door actuator feedback circuits to determine the mode door actuator position by the position of the actuator feedback resistor wiper arm.

Door actuator feed B circuits
- Blend - 1376 (BK/LB)
- Defrost - 1137 (YE/LG)
- Floor/Panel - 1129 (BN/WH)

Door actuator feed A circuits
- Blend - 1375 (PK/YE)
- Defrost - 1136 (RD/WH)
- Floor/Panel - 1128 (GY/LB)

Door actuator return circuits
- Blend - 438 (RD/WH)
- Defrost - 438 (RD/WH)
- Floor/Panel - 438 (RD/WH)

Door actuator reference circuits
- Blend - 436 (RD/LG)
- Defrost - 436 (RD/LG)
- Floor/Panel - 436 (RD/LG)

Door actuator feedback circuits
- Blend - 437 (YE/LG)
- Defrost - 1982 (LB/BK)
- Floor/Panel - 435 (YE/LB)

Possible Causes
- An open, short to voltage, ground or together in door actuator open, close, return, reference or feedback circuits
- Blend, air inlet, defrost and floor/panel mode door actuator motor
- EATC module
- Manual climate control module
- Stuck or bound linkage or door
